Match each equation with its solution set.
taurus [48]

Answer:

1- The solution of I2x + 5I = 9 is {-7 , 2}

2- The solution of I2x + 7I + 2 = 11 is {-8 , 1}

3- The solution of I5 - xI = 6 is {-1 , 11}

4- The solution of I6x - 8I + 7 = 5 is ∅

5- The solution of Ix + 3I = 12 is {-15 , 9}

6- The solution of Ix - 3I = -12 is ∅

Step-by-step explanation:

* At first lets explain the meaning of IxI = a

- If IxI = a ⇒ then x = a or x = -a

- IxI never give a negative answer, because IxI means the

 magnitude of x is always positive

Ex: I-2I is 2

* Now lets find the solution of each equation

1- ∵ I2x + 5I = 9

∴ 2x + 5 = 9 ⇒ subtract 5 from both sides

∴ 2x = 4 ⇒ divide both sides by 2

∴ x = 2

OR

∴ 2x + 5 = -9 ⇒ subtract 5 from both sides

∴ 2x = -14 ⇒ divide both sides by 2

∴ x = -7

* The solution of I2x + 5I = 9 is {-7 , 2}

2- ∵ I2x + 7I + 2 = 11 ⇒ Subtract 2 from both sides

∴ I2x + 7I = 9

∴ 2x + 7 = 9 ⇒ subtract 7 from both sides

∴ 2x = 2 ⇒ divide both sides by 2

∴ x = 1

OR

∴ 2x + 7 = -9 ⇒ subtract 7 from both sides

∴ 2x = -16 ⇒ divide both sides by 2

∴ x = -8

* The solution of I2x + 7I + 2 = 11 is {-8 , 1}

3- ∵ I5 - xI = 6

∴ 5 -x = 6 ⇒ subtract 5 from both sides

∴ -x = 1 ⇒ divide both sides by -1

∴ x = -1

OR

∴ 5 -x = -6 ⇒ subtract 5 from both sides

∴ -x = -11 ⇒ divide both sides by -1

∴ x = 11

* The solution of I5 - xI = 6 is {-1 , 11}

4- ∵ I6x - 8I + 7 = 5 ⇒ Subtract 7 from both sides

∴ I6x - 8I = -2

- I  I never give negative answer

* The solution of I6x - 8I + 7 = 5 is ∅

5- ∵ Ix + 3I = 12

∴ x + 3 = 12 ⇒ subtract 3 from both sides

∴ x = 9

OR

∴ x + 3 = -12 ⇒ subtract 3 from both sides

∴ x = -15

* The solution of Ix + 3I = 12 is {-15 , 9}

6- ∵ Ix - 3I = -12

- I  I never give negative answer

* The solution of Ix - 3I = -12 is ∅
